概括
社区服务组织因资源限制而面临结果测量和报告方面的挑战. 评估能力建设计划可以提高技能,但实施障碍,如劳动力限制和不清楚的流程需要解决成功.

背景情况:
- 社区服务组织 (CSO) 面临着越来越多的结果报告需求,与临床环境相比,这是一个新的挑战.
- 农村的民间社会组织经历了更多的资源和系统限制,使评估工作复杂化.
- 评估能力建设对于民间社会组织有效衡量和报告计划交付至关重要.
研究的目的:
- 报告澳大利亚农村社会组织评估能力建设计划的形成性评估.
- 评估监测,评估和学习 (MEL) 试点对员工对结果测量的信心的影响.
- 确定在基于地点的社区服务环境中实施MEL实践的障碍和推动因素.
主要方法:
- 使用Reach有效性采用实施维护 (RE-AIM) 框架进行形成性评估.
- 实施MEL试点,包括培训,框架开发,数据收集工具和为4个团队 (12人) 提供学术支持.
- 通过行政记录和工作人员调查收集数据.
主要成果:
- 参与者在培训后表现出高度的MEL意识,知识和技能.
- 主要障碍包括劳动力能力,竞争优先事项,人员变更,不清楚的流程和组织问题.
- 激励因素包括身体存在,灵活性和开放的沟通.
结论:
- 加强组织的评估文化对于持续的成功至关重要.
- 建议简化结果测量和数据收集.
- 更广泛的员工队伍的更大参与提高了评估购买和有效性.

The evaluation stage signals the end of the nursing process. The nurse gathers evaluative data to assess whether or not the patient has attained the expected results. Whereas the nurse collects data in the nursing assessment to identify the patient's health concerns, the evaluation stage data determines if the indicated health issues are resolved. Evaluative data collection includes two sections: the data acquired to evaluate patient outcomes and the time criteria for data collection.

As the human population continues to grow and use resources, we must be mindful of our planet’s natural limits. Sustainable development provides a pathway to maintain and improve human life now while also ensuring that future generations will have the resources that they need. The long-term success of sustainability efforts rests on understanding the interplay between human actions and ecological systems.

Researchers have tested many persuasion strategies, including the foot-in-the door and the door-in-the-face techniques, in a variety of contexts. Ultimately, the principles are effective in selling products and changing people’s attitude, ideas, and behaviors (Cialdini & Goldstein, 2004).
